Ukwakha Udokotela Wamaterorogist Wezimo Ezibonakalayo Esebenzisa Ama-Agents we-Amazon Bedrock

Ukuhlanganiswa kwamandla we-AI akhiqizayo kuyindlela yokuguqula izinguquko ezimbonini eziningi. Yize imininingwane yesimo sezulu itholakala ngeziteshi eziningi, amabhizinisi athembela kakhulu kwidatha ye-meteorological adinga izixazululo eziqinile futhi ezinokalisiwe ukuphatha ngempumelelo nokusebenzisa lezi zinqubo ezibucayi futhi anciphise izinqubo ezibucayi futhi zinciphise izinqubo ezibucayi futhi zinciphise izinqubo ezibucayi futhi zinciphise izinqubo ezibucayi futhi zinciphise izinqubo ezibalulekile. Lesi sixazululo sibonisa ukuthi ungawakha kanjani i-semeteorologist ye-virtual enamandla ebonakalayo engaphendula imibuzo eyinkimbinkimbi yesimo sezulu ngolimi lwemvelo. Sisebenzisa izinsizakalo ezahlukahlukene ze-AWS ukuhambisa ikhambi eliphelele ongalisebenzisa ukuxhumana ne-API enikezela ngemininingwane yesimo sezulu sangempela. Kulesixazululo, sisebenzisa ama-Amazon Bedrock Agents.
Ama-ejenti we-Amazon Bedrock asiza ekuhambiseni ukuhamba komsebenzi futhi ashintshe imisebenzi ephindaphindwayo. Ama-ejenti we-Amazon Bedrock angaxhuma ngokuphepha kwimithombo yedatha yenkampani yakho futhi akhulise isicelo somsebenzisi ngezimpendulo ezinembile. Ungasebenzisa ama-Amazon Bedrock Agents e-Architect anction action schema ehambisane nezidingo zakho, ekunikeze ukulawula noma nini lapho umenzeli eqala isenzo esibekiwe. Le ndlela eguquguqukayo ikuhlomisa ukuze uhlanganise umthungo futhi ukhiphe logic yebhizinisi ngaphakathi kwensizakalo yakho oyithandayo ye-backunder insizakalo, ukukhuthaza inhlanganisela yokubumbana kokusebenza nokuvumelana nezimo. Kukhona nokugcinwa kwememori kulokhu kuhlangana okuvumela umuzwa oqondene nomuntu owenzelwe wena.
Kulokhu okuthunyelwe, sethula indlela ehlelwe kabusha yokusebenzisa i-ejenti enamandla ai ngokuhlanganisa ama-Amazon Bedrock Agents kanye nemodeli yesisekelo (FM). Sikuqondisa ngenqubo yokumisa i-ejenti nokusebenzisa i-logic ethize edingekayo kudokotela wezimpendulo ze-meteorologist ukuhlinzeka ngezimpendulo ezihlobene nesimo sezulu. Ngokwengeziwe, sisebenzisa izinsizakalo ezahlukahlukene ze-AWS, kufaka phakathi ama-AWS akhulisekile ekusingatheni ukuphela kwangaphambili, imisebenzi ye-AWS Lambda yokuphatha i-Logic, i-Amazon Cognito yokufaka ubuqiniso bomsebenzisi, kanye nokuphathwa kokufinyelela (i-IAM) ngokulawula ukufinyelela kumenzeli.
Ukubuka konke
Umdwebo unikeza ukubuka konke futhi uqokomise izingxenye ezisemqoka. Ukwakhiwa kwezakhiwo usebenzisa i-Amazon Cognito yokufakazelwa ubuqiniso komsebenzisi futhi ngenze lula ukuba indawo yokusingathwa kwesicelo sethu sangaphambili. Ama-ejenti we-Amazon Bedrock adlulisela imininingwane evela kumbuzo womsebenzisi emaqenjini ezenzweni, abuye anikeze imisebenzi yangokwezifiso yeLambda. Iqembu ngalinye lesenzo kanye nomsebenzi weLambda uphatha umsebenzi othile:
- I-Geo-Coordinates – Izinqubo Zokuxhumanisa Kwendawo (i-Geo-Coordinates) ukuthola imininingwane mayelana nendawo ethile
- Isimo sezulu – Kubutha imininingwane yesimo sezulu yendawo enikeziwe
- Isikhathi Sosuku – Ithola usuku lwamanje nesikhathi
Izimfuneko
Kufanele ube nalokhu okulandelayo endaweni yokugcwalisa isixazululo kulokhu okuthunyelwe:
Thumela Izinsizakusebenza Zesisombululo usebenzisa i-AWS Cloudformation
Lapho usebenzisa ithempulethi ye-AWS Cloudformation, izinsiza ezilandelayo zithunyelwe (Qaphela ukuthi izindleko zizotholwa izinsiza ze-AWS ezisetshenzisiwe):
- Izinsizakusebenza ze-Amazon Cognito:
- Izinsizakusebenza zeLambda:
- Sebenza –
-geo-coordinates- - Sebenza –
-weather- - Sebenza –
-date-time-
- Sebenza –
- Ama-Agents we-Amazon Bedrock: Udokotela we-Virtual-Meteorologist
- Amaqembu Ezenzo (1) –
obtain-latitude-longitude-from-place-name
- Amaqembu Ezenzo (2) –
obtain-weather-information-with-coordinates
- Amaqembu Ezenzo (3) –
get-current-date-time-from-timezone
- Amaqembu Ezenzo (1) –
Ngemuva kokuthumela ithempulethi ye-Cloudformation, Kopisha okulandelayo kusuka ku Okuphumayo Ithebhu ku-Cloudformation Console ezosetshenziswa ngesikhathi sokucushwa kwesicelo sakho ngemuva kokuthi ifakwe kuma-AWS Aliclive.
AWSRegion
BedrockAgentAliasId
BedrockAgentId
BedrockAgentName
IdentityPoolId
UserPoolClientId
UserPoolId
Sebenzisa uhlelo lokusebenza lwe-AWS AM AMLY
Udinga ukuthumela ngesandla uhlelo lokukhulisa usebenzisa ikhodi engaphambili etholakala ku-GitHub. Qedela lezi zinyathelo ezilandelayo:
- Landa ikhodi engaphambili ye-AWS-AmAmed-frontind.zip kusuka ku-GitHub.
- Sebenzisa ifayela le-.Zip ukuze usebenzise kabusha uhlelo lokusebenza nge-ALMFENCE.
- Buyela ekhasini lokukhulisa futhi usebenzise isizinda esikhiqizwa ngokuzenzakalelayo ukufinyelela uhlelo lokusebenza.
Sebenzisa i-Amazon Cognito ngokuqinisekiswa komsebenzisi
I-Amazon Cognito insiza kamazisi ongayisebenzisa ukuqinisekisa futhi igunyaze abasebenzisi. Sisebenzisa i-Amazon Cognito kwisixazululo sethu ukuqinisekisa umsebenzisi ngaphambi kokusebenzisa uhlelo lokusebenza. Siphinde sisebenzise i-IDITY POOL ukuhlinzeka ngeziqinisekiso ze-AWS zesikhashana zomsebenzisi ngenkathi zisebenzisana ne-Amazon Bedrock API.
Sebenzisa ama-Amazon Bedrock Agents ukushintshanisa imisebenzi yohlelo lokusebenza
Nge-Amazon Bedrock Agents, ungakha futhi ulungiselele ama-ejenti ezizimele kuhlelo lwakho lokusebenza. I-ejenti isiza abasebenzisi bakho bokugcina izenzo ezisuselwa kwimininingwane yenhlangano nokufakwa komsebenzisi. Ama-ejenti ama-Orchestrate Ukuxhumana phakathi kwe-FMS, imithombo yedatha, izinhlelo zokusebenza zesoftware, nezingxoxo zabasebenzisi.
Sebenzisa iqembu lesenzo ukuchaza izenzo ezenziwa ama-Amazon Bedrock Agents
Iqembu lesenzo lichaza isethi yezenzo ezihlobene ne-Amazon Bedrock Agent enze ukusiza ukusiza abasebenzisi. Lapho ulungiselela iqembu lesenzo, unezinketho zokusingathwa kwemininingwane enikezwe ngumsebenzisi, kufaka phakathi ukufakwa komsebenzisi eqenjini lesenzo se-Agent, kudluliswa idatha kumsebenzi we-lambda logic, noma ukulawulwa kokubuyisa ngqo ngempendulo evumayo. Ngohlelo lwethu lokusebenza, sakha amaqembu amathathu ezenzo ukuthi anikeze i-Amazon Bedrock Agent le nsiza ebalulekile: Ukubuyisa izixhumanisi zezindawo ezithile, ukuthola imininingwane yesikhathi samanje kanye nesikhathi, kanye nokulanda idatha yesimo sezulu ngezindawo ezinikezwe. Lawa maqembu ezenzo anika amandla i-ejenti ukuthi afinyelele futhi acubungule imininingwane ebalulekile, athuthukise amandla ayo okuphendula ngokunembile nangokuqondakala emikhondweni yomsebenzisi ehlobene nezinsizakalo ezenzelwe indawo kanye nezimo zezulu.
Sebenzisa i-Lambda ye-Amazon Bedrock Action Group
Njengengxenye yalesi sixazululo, imisebenzi emithathu ye-lambda ihanjiswa ukusekela amaqembu ezenzo achazwe nge-Amazon Bedrock Agent yethu:
- Indawo ixhumanisa umsebenzi we-lambda – Lo msebenzi udalwe yi
obtain-latitude-longitude-from-place-name
iqembu lesenzo. Kuthatha igama lendawo njengokufaka futhi kubuyisa izixhumanisi ezihambisanayo nobude. Umsebenzi usebenzisa insizakalo ye-geocoding noma database ukwenza lokhu kubheka. - Usuku nesikhathi umsebenzi we-lambda – kufakwe yi-
get-current-date-time-from-timezone
Iqembu lesenzo, lo msebenzi uhlinzeka ngolwazi lwamanje nolwazi lwesikhathi. - Imininingwane Yesimo Sezulu Umsebenzi weLambda – Lo msebenzi ubizwe ngu
obtain-weather-information-with-coordinates
iqembu lesenzo. Yamukela ukuxhumanisa kwe-geo kusuka emsebenzini wokuqala we-lambda futhi ibuyisa izimo zezulu zamanje nokubikezela kwendawo ebekiwe. Lo msebenzi we-lambda usebenzise i-api yesimo sezulu ukuyolanda idatha ye-meteorological esesikhathini.
Ngayinye yale misebenzi ye-lambda ithola umcimbi wokufaka oqukethe ama-metadata afanele kanye nezinkundla ezinabantu abavela ekusebenzeni kwe-API ka-Asment ye-Amazon Bedrock Agent noma amapharamitha. Imisebenzi icubungula lokhu okokufaka, yenza imisebenzi yayo ethile, bese ubuyisela impendulo ngolwazi oludingekayo. Le mpendulo isetshenziswa yi-Amazon Bedrock Agent ukwakha impendulo yayo embuzweni womsebenzisi. Ngokusebenzisa le misebenzi ye-lambda, i-Amazon Bedrock Agent ithola amandla okuthola imithombo yedatha yangaphandle futhi enze amakhono ayinkimbinkimbi, athuthukise kakhulu amandla awo ekusingatheni izicelo zomsebenzisi ezihlobene nendawo, isikhathi, kanye nemininingwane yesimo sezulu.
Sebenzisa ama-AWS akhulisa ikhodi yangaphambili
I-Alipelly inikeza indawo yokuthuthuka yokwakha okuphephile, okubukeka kahle kanye ne-web application. Onjiniyela bangagxila kwikhodi yabo kunokuba bakhathazeke ngengqalasizinda engaphansi. I-Alebhusayithi kahle futhi ihlangana nabahlinzeki abaningi be-git. Ngalesi sixazululo, silayisha ngesandla ikhodi yethu yangaphambili esebenzisa indlela echazwe ngaphambili kulokhu okuthunyelwe.
Ukuhamba kwesicelo
Zulazulela ku-URL enikezwe ngemuva kokudala uhlelo lokusebenza nge-ALMFENTEL. Lapho ufinyelela i-URL yesicelo, uzokwaziswa ukuthi unikeze imininingwane ehlobene ne-Amazon Cognito ne-Amazon Bedrock Agents. Lolu lwazi luyadingeka ukuthi luqinisekise abasebenzisi ngokuphepha futhi luvumele ukuphela kwangaphambili ukuthi uhlanganyele ne-Amazon Bedrock Agent. Inika amandla uhlelo lokusebenza ukuphatha izikhathi zomsebenzisi futhi lwenze izingcingo ezigunyaziwe ze-API ezinsizakalweni ze-AWS egameni lomsebenzisi.
Ungafaka imininingwane ngamanani owaqoqe kusuka ekuphumeni kwesitaki se-Cloudformation. Uzocelwa ukuthi ufake izinkambu ezilandelayo, njengoba kukhonjisiwe ku-skrini elandelayo:
- I-ID Yomsebenzisi
- I-POOL Pool Clientiod
- I-ID kamazisi
- Indawo
- Igama Lomenzeli
- I-ID ye-Agent
- I-Agent Alias ID
- Indawo
Udinga ukungena ngemvume ngegama lakho lomsebenzisi nephasiwedi. Iphasiwedi yesikhashana yakhiqizwa ngokuzenzakalelayo ngesikhathi sokuhanjiswa futhi yathunyelwa ekhelini le-imeyili olinikele lapho sethula ithempulethi ye-Cloudformation. Ekuqaleni kokungena ngemvume kokungena ngemvume, uzocelwa ukuthi usethe kabusha iphasiwedi yakho, njengoba kukhonjisiwe kuvidiyo elandelayo.
Manje usungaqala ukubuza imibuzo kuhlelo lokusebenza, ngokwesibonelo, “Singakwazi yini ukwenza izombuzo namuhla eDallas, TX?” Ngemizuzwana embalwa, uhlelo lokusebenza luzokunikeza imiphumela enemininingwane ekhulumayo uma ungenza izoso le-barbecue eDallas, TX. Ividiyo elandelayo ikhombisa le ngxoxo.
Isibonelo Sebenzisa amacala
Nansi imibuzo eyisampula embalwa ukukhombisa amakhono wesazi sakho se-meteorologist:
- “Sinjani isimo sezulu eNew York City namuhla?”
- “Ngabe kufanele ngihlele iphathi yokuzalwa yangaphandle eMiami ngempelasonto ezayo?”
- “Kuzoba iqhwa eDenver ngosuku lukaKhisimusi?”
- “Ngingakwazi ukubhukuda olwandle eChicago namuhla?
Le mibuzo ikhombisa ikhono le-ejenti yokuhlinzeka ngemininingwane yesimo sezulu samanje, inikezela ngezeluleko ezisuselwa ekubikezelweni kwesimo sezulu, futhi sibikezele izimo zezulu zesikhathi esizayo. Ungabuza ngisho nombuzo ohlobene nomsebenzi njengokubhukuda, futhi uzophendula ngokusekelwe ezimweni zezulu uma lowo msebenzi ulungile ukwenza.
Hlanza
Uma uthatha isinqumo sokuyeka ukusebenzisa udokotela we-meteorologist, ungalandela lezi zinyathelo ukuze uyisuse, izinsiza zayo ezihambisana nazo zisetshenziswa kusetshenziswa amathuba amasha, kanye nokuthunyelwa kwezeluleko:
- Susa isitaki se-Cloudformation:
- Ku-AWS Cloud Cloudformation Console, khetha Izithinca kufasitelana lokuzulazula.
- Thola isitaki osidalile ngesikhathi senqubo yokuhambisa (owabelwe igama).
- Khetha isitaki bese ukhetha Cisha.
- Susa uhlelo lokusebenza lwe-AMALLYNDY kanye nezinsizakusebenza zalo. Ngemiyalo, bheka Ukuhlanza Izinsizakusebenza.
Ukugcina
Lesi sixazululo sikhombisa amandla okuhlanganisa ama-Amazon Bedrock Agents namanye ama-AWS Services ukudala umsizi wesimo sezulu ohlakaniphile, wokuguqula. Ngokusebenzisa ubuchwepheshe be-AI nefu, amabhizinisi angasebenzisa imibuzo eyinkimbinkimbi futhi anikeze ukuqonda okubalulekile kubasebenzisi bawo.
Izinsizakusebenza ezingeziwe
Ukuze ufunde kabanzi nge-Amazon Bedrock, bheka izinsiza ezilandelayo:
Ukuze ufunde kabanzi ngemodeli ye-Anthropic's Claude 3.5 Sonnet Model, bheka izinsiza ezilandelayo:
Mayelana nababhali
USalman Ahmed ngumphathi we-akhawunti we-applity ephezulu yezobuchwepheshe ekusekelweni kwebhizinisi le-AWS. Uyakujabulela ukusiza amakhasimende embonini yokuhamba nowokungenisa izihambi ukuklama, ukusebenzisa, nokusekela ingqalasizinda yefu. Ngothando lwezinsizakalo zokuxhumana kanye neminyaka yesipiliyoni, usiza amakhasimende ukuthi asebenzise izinsizakalo ezahlukahlukene zokuxhumana ze-AWS. Ngaphandle komsebenzi, uSalman uyakujabulela ukuthwebula izithombe, ukuhamba, nokubuka amaqembu akhe ayizintandokazi ezemidlalo.
Sergio Barraza Ingabe ukuhola okuphezulu kwebhizinisi okuphezulu ku-AWS, ukusiza amakhasimende wamandla aklanywe futhi asebenzise kahle izixazululo zamafu. Ngesifiso sokuthuthukiswa kwesoftware, uqondisa amakhasimende amandla nge-AWS Service Adoption. Umsebenzi wangaphandle, iSergio iyisigingini sensimbi ehlukahlukene edlala isiginci, upiyano, kanye nezigubhu, futhi futhi yenza futhi iphiko chun kung fung fu.
URavi Kumar ngumphathi we-akhawunti we-applity ophezulu ku-AWS Enterprise ukweseka okusiza amakhasimende embonini yezokuvakasha kanye nomoya wokungenisa izihambi ukuqondisa imisebenzi yabo yamafu emathul. Ungumphumela we-It uchwepheshe ngeminyaka engaphezu kwengu-20 yesipiliyoni. Esikhathini sakhe samahhala, iRavi ijabulela imisebenzi yokudala efana nokupenda. Ubuye athande ukudlala ikhilikithi nokuhambela izindawo ezintsha.
I-Ankush Goyal Ingabe i-Enterprise Support eholwa ekusekelweni kwebhizinisi le-AWS esiza amakhasimende ukuthi anikeze amandla okusebenza kwawo amafu ngama-AWS. Ungumphumela we-It uchwepheshe ngeminyaka engaphezu kwengu-20 yesipiliyoni.